New Library at Rajiv Gandhi National Institute of Youth Development (RGNIYD)

A Central Library to provide easy access to researchers and students of youth-related studies, set up at a cost of Rs.20 crore, at the Rajiv Gandhi National Institute of Youth Development, Sriperumbudur, was inaugurated on Tuesday.

According to a press release, facilities such as e-library, intranet and internet-connected digital library, translation of youth-related learning material, articles published in journals, case studies, and classics in different languages will be available in the library along with books, journals, working papers, reports, and documentaries on youth development and allied fields.

The RGNIYD Central Library has been linked with the knowledge network under the Knowledge Mission of the Government of India.
